Starter Kits: Budget-Friendly Options
Among the most economical options are basic starter kits, which usually include everything needed to get started with vaping. These kits can range from as low as $20 to $40. Despite their affordability, they often include essentials like a rechargeable battery, a charger, and a cartridge or tank. For those new to vaping, these kits offer a simple introduction without financial commitment.
Mid-range e-cigarettes typically cost between $40 and $100. These devices provide a balance between basic functionality and quality enhancements, offering better battery life, adjustable settings, and sometimes refillable tanks. For users looking to upgrade from a starter kit, this category offers a more customizable and refined vaping experience.
High-End Products: Luxury in Vaping
If you’re considering high-end vaping devices, expect prices to range from $100 to $250 and beyond. These high-tech devices often feature advanced controls, temperature settings, and sleek designs aimed at enhancing every session. Investing in these products can bring a premium experience to the user.
Pod Systems: The Modern Choice
Pod systems are gaining popularity due to their convenience and compact nature. Prices for pod systems generally range from around $15 for basic models to $50 for higher quality versions. These systems use pre-filled or refillable pods, ensuring a hassle-free vaping experience suitable for both beginners and seasoned vapers.
Factors Influencing E-Cigarette Prices
Several factors play a role in determining the cost of e-cigarettes. Brand reputation, technological features, battery life, and the materials used can impact the overall price. Additionally, the availability of customizable options can significantly increase the cost, as these features cater to specific user preferences.
